Daniel Runs Into Peterson's Set

We happened upon the table with about 400,000 in the pot and a board reading . It appeared Ryan Daniel had checked, and Wayne Peterson had moved all in for 323,000.
Daniel was contemplating the call, asking his opponent a lot of questions like, "Do you have ace-queen?" and "A set?" Peterson, who was getting a massage, buried his head in his massage pad and refused to answer.
Daniel thought for a long time, counting out chips and asking for an exact count, and then said, "I call." Peterson then looked up, rolled over , and doubled on the hand.
Daniel was clearly disappointed as he was left with just 12,000, all of which disappeared in the very next hand.
